Music that bears repeating

Music that bears repeating

Forms of repetition are explored on this week’s episode of ‘Extra Eclectic.’ We hear selections including ‘Divine Objects’ from Johann Johannsson’s ‘Drone Mass,’ the ‘Chaconni’ from Jennifer Higdon’s Violin Concerto, John Corigliano’s ‘Fantasia on an Ostinato’ and much more. Bastille Day

Bastille Day

This week on Saturday Cinema, host Lynne Warfel celebrates Bastille Day with a show dedicated to movies set in, made in or about France, including ‘Umbrellas of Cherbourg,’ ‘Irma Le Douce,’ ‘Casablanca’ and more. Listen now!

Classical Queery: 'What is the power of community?'

Classical Queery: 'What is the power of community?'

In celebration of Pride, host Mya Temanson presents Classical Queery, a series that illustrates how classical music can uplift queer voices and how queer experiences can transform the classical music scene. This week, Waigwa of One Voice Mixed Chorus answers the question, ‘What is the power of community?’
